DOCTOR RECOMMENDED RELIEF FOR BED SORES & ULCERS: Providing relief from bed sores and ulcers that result from being bedridden, the alternating pressure mattress instantly promotes increased circulation and helps manage skin maceration. The variable pressure mattress evenly distributes weight and relieves pressure spots–instantly improving your loved one’s quality of life. Perfect for immobilized, bedridden patients who cannot shift their weight frequently.
ADVANCED WAVE-LIKE THERAPY WITH 130 AIR CELLS: Our proprietary algorithm alternately inflates and deflates each of the pad’s 130 air cells, creating a mattress surface that evenly distributes a patient or loved one’s weight and instantly eliminates pressure spots. Each air cell is heat sealed to ensure it will not leak for exceptional durability.
WHISPER-QUIET PUMP WITH CUSTOMIZABLE CONTROLS: Variable pressure pump is ultra-quiet for restful sleep. Producing constant air flow, the variable pump offers multiple levels of pressure for a customizable experience. Each pressure cycle is approximately six minutes long.
TRUSTED DURABLE CONSTRUCTION SUPPORTS UP TO 300 LBS & IS WATERPROOF: Premium vinyl mattress supports up to 300 pounds. The waterproof mattress pad easily fits on an existing mattress or frame. The included air hoses are flexible and non-binding for easy installation.

Almost perfect product
I had delayed getting this after reports that the ones from our local medical equipment supplier were very noisy.Then, when I saw this item described as ‘whisper quiet”, I thought I’d put it to the test.It passed! In fact, it is so quiet that you sometimes wonder if it has stopped working.It does what it says it would, and the risk of bed sores is all but goneI said almost peefect because there is one thing I’d like to see added to the design: instead of a flap to tuck under the mattress it would have been better to have a pocket to put the mattress into at the head of the bed. This would prevent the device from slowly moving towards the foot of the bed as the patient is raised and lowered for feeding and resting.A small deficiency in an otherwise excellent product.

Works very well once you figure out how you wanna set it
Very comfortable and very quiet. I can hardly hear the motor at all. Only concern is that it can be slow to inflate and the inflation may not be that even. The configuration of the inflated balloons (I’m not sure what to call them) are such that you can tell the ones that are inflated and the ones that are not which, at first, left a very mild discomfort. I said the setting way down and it doesn’t appear to bother me anymore. Additionally, I turned it off when I’m not in bed so it does not overinflate without any weight against it. That may have helped as well. Finally, since it’s been used on a hospital bed, when the head of the bed or the foot of the bed is folded, it appears as if the air does not get to some of those sections as efficiently. Overall, I am very pleased with the product and can recommend it.
